  • Patent number: 4812890
    Abstract: A method of fabricating bipolar intergratable transistors includes a recrystallization step. A monocrystalline epitaxial layer is deposited upon a highly doped substrate and impurities are introduced into a portion of the epitaxial layer to form a first transistor region. A polysilicon layer is deposited upon the surface and a portion of the polycrystalline layer is recrystallized wherein the first transistor region serves as a seed. Impurities are introduced into the recrystallized portion to form a base. An additional polysilicon layer is deposited over the substrate and a portion is recrystallized wherein the base serves as a seed. A second transistor region is formed in the recrystallized portion of the additional polysilicon layer.

  • Patent number: 4539501
    Abstract: An epitaxial structure in which a constraint imposed by forced epitaxy causes an increase in the piezoelectric effect of a group of layers. The structure which provides this effect utilizes a semi-insulating substrate made from a first material on which is deposited by forced epitaxy a layer of a second material, the two materials are in crystalline mesh parameter disharmony, which creates in said layer a constraint increasing its piezoelectricity. On the constrained layer are deposited two groups of alternated "deforming" and "deformed" layers of the two materials. The thickness of the structure is sufficient to allow propagation of the surface waves. The advantage of this structure is that it allows two transducers such as transistors to be integrated on or at the side of this structure.

  • Patent number: 4377760
    Abstract: An analog device for reading a quantity of electric charge, for example, in a transversal charge transfer filter. The device includes a capacitor and two MOS transistors which are connected in series to the point in the filter where the charge is to be read. The capacitor is connected to the common point of the two transistors which are controlled in phase opposition to insure charging of the capacitor. The capacitor maintains a potential at the charge reading point constant. Any variation in the quantity of charge under an electrode is converted into a variation of potential at the common point and this forms the read signal which is detected by means of a third MOS transistor.
